prosolis 8863b75916 Fix push SSRF, cross-user unsub, and personalization edge cases
Code review of the personalization/feeds/PWA/push work surfaced ten
confirmed issues, now fixed:

- Web Push delivery bypassed the SSRF guard (unguarded default client);
  now routes through safehttp.NewClient with a hard timeout, and the
  subscribe handler validates the endpoint URL.
- Push unsubscribe deleted by endpoint with no owner check; added
  RemovePushSubscriptionForUser scoped to the signed-in user.
- Byte-slice body/content truncation could split a UTF-8 rune and break
  the RSS content:encoded XML; added a rune-safe truncateUTF8 helper.
- Digest sender could permanently starve a user who hid a high-volume
  source; step the watermark past a full hidden-source scan window.
- Service worker cached personalized HTML navigations into a shared
  cache (identity leak across PWA users); navigations are now
  network-only, CACHE_VERSION bumped to v2 to purge stale pages.
- Public /api/article leaked discarded/unclassified bodies; filter to
  classified, non-sentinel stories.
- runLocal never started the push sender; digests now fire in -local.
- Push client had no timeout, so one hung endpoint stalled all sends.
- Reader migration resurrected cross-device-cleared reads; gate it
  behind a one-time flag so the server stays authoritative.
- Bookmarks count didn't match the classified list filter.

package storage
import "fmt"
// PushSubscription is one browser/device endpoint a signed-in user has opted in
// for Web Push digests. See the push_subscriptions schema for the field roles.
type PushSubscription struct {
Endpoint string
UserSub string
P256dh string
Auth string
CreatedAt int64
LastNotifiedAt int64
}
// AddPushSubscription records (or refreshes) a push endpoint for a user. The
// endpoint is the primary key, so a re-subscribe from the same browser updates
// the keys and resets the digest watermark to now — the user shouldn't be
// paged for everything published before they opted in.
func AddPushSubscription(sub, endpoint, p256dh, auth string) error {
now := nowUnix()
_, err := Get().Exec(`
INSERT INTO push_subscriptions (endpoint, user_sub, p256dh, auth, created_at, last_notified_at)
VALUES (?, ?, ?, ?, ?, ?)
ON CONFLICT(endpoint) DO UPDATE SET
user_sub = excluded.user_sub,
p256dh = excluded.p256dh,
auth = excluded.auth,
last_notified_at = excluded.last_notified_at`,
endpoint, sub, p256dh, auth, now, now)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("add push subscription: %w", err)
}
return nil
}
// RemovePushSubscription drops one endpoint regardless of owner. Reserved for
// the digest sender's prune path, where a push service has reported the endpoint
// gone (404/410) and there's no caller identity to scope by. User-initiated
// opt-outs must use RemovePushSubscriptionForUser.
func RemovePushSubscription(endpoint string) error {
_, err := Get().Exec(`DELETE FROM push_subscriptions WHERE endpoint = ?`, endpoint)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("remove push subscription: %w", err)
}
return nil
}
// RemovePushSubscriptionForUser drops an endpoint only if it belongs to sub, so
// a signed-in user can't unsubscribe another account's device by presenting its
// endpoint string. A no-op (no matching row) is not an error.
func RemovePushSubscriptionForUser(sub, endpoint string) error {
_, err := Get().Exec(
`DELETE FROM push_subscriptions WHERE endpoint = ? AND user_sub = ?`, endpoint, sub)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("remove push subscription: %w", err)
}
return nil
}
// ListPushSubscriptions returns every stored subscription, for the digest sender.
func ListPushSubscriptions() ([]PushSubscription, error) {
rows, err := Get().Query(
`SELECT endpoint, user_sub, p256dh, auth, created_at, last_notified_at
FROM push_subscriptions`)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er rows.Close()
var out []PushSubscription
for rows.Next() {
var p PushSubscription
if err := rows.Scan(&p.Endpoint, &p.UserSub, &p.P256dh, &p.Auth, &p.CreatedAt, &p.LastNotifiedAt); err != nil {
return nil, err
}
out = append(out, p)
}
return out, rows.Err()
}
// TouchPushSubscription advances an endpoint's digest watermark so its next
// digest only considers stories seen after ts.
func TouchPushSubscription(endpoint string, ts int64) error {
_, err := Get().Exec(
`UPDATE push_subscriptions SET last_notified_at = ? WHERE endpoint = ?`, ts, endpoint)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("touch push subscription: %w", err)
}
return nil
}
// NewClassifiedSince returns classified stories first seen after sinceUnix,
// newest first, capped at limit. The digest sender uses it to count and preview
// what's new for a subscriber; it carries just the fields a digest needs.
func NewClassifiedSince(sinceUnix int64, limit int) ([]Story, error) {
rows, err := Get().Query(
`SELECT id, headline, source, channel, seen_at
FROM stories
WHERE classified = 1 AND channel <> '_discarded' AND seen_at > ?
ORDER BY seen_at DESC
LIMIT ?`, sinceUnix, limit)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er rows.Close()
var out []Story
for rows.Next() {
var s Story
if err := rows.Scan(&s.ID, &s.Headline, &s.Source, &s.Channel, &s.SeenAt); err != nil {
return nil, err
}
out = append(out, s)
}
return out, rows.Err()
}
